CASTECH's GRT-KTP, as a fantastic NLO crystal, has decrease absorption and higher damage threshold than the traditional KTP, which we are able to conclude it possesses a higher grey monitor resistance.
Its hottest application is like a frequency doubler using the 1064nm output of a Nd:YAG laser also to produce 532nm laser. KTP’s Homes also help it become outstanding for electro-optic modulation, optical parametric generation.
These types of crystals have a reduced Preliminary IR absorption and therefore are a lot less afflicted by environmentally friendly light-weight than frequent KTP, thus steer clear of the problems of harmonic electric power instabilities, effectiveness drops, crystal blackening, and beam distortion.
Additionally, the closed autoclave advancement program permits zero to minimal chemical impurities plus the constant development rate lends a fantastic homogeneity or uniform generate throughout the bulk crystal.
The crystals are generally accustomed to double the frequency click here of Nd:YAG and Nd:YVO�?lasers, producing obvious environmentally friendly laser output (532 nm) from the elemental 1064 nm wavelength.
